Top coding languages to learn
If you are considering a career in programming or looking to expand your coding skills, it is important to choose the right programming language to learn. With so many programming languages available, it can be overwhelming to decide where to start. However, here are some of the top coding languages that are worth considering:
1. Python
Python is an excellent programming language for beginners. It is known for its simplicity and readability, making it easy to learn and understand. Python has a wide range of applications, from web development to data analysis and artificial intelligence. It is also highly popular in the scientific community for its extensive libraries and frameworks.
2. JavaScript
JavaScript is a must-learn language for anyone interested in web development. It is the language of the web, allowing you to add interactivity and dynamic content to websites. JavaScript is also widely used for creating mobile applications, server-side development, and game development. With the rise of front-end frameworks like React and Vue.js, JavaScript has become even more popular in recent years.
3. Java
Java is one of the oldest and most widely used programming languages. It is known for its platform independence, which means that Java programs can run on any device or operating system. Java is widely used for creating desktop applications, web applications, and Android applications. It is also the language of choice for large-scale enterprise-level projects.
4. C++
C++ is a powerful programming language that is widely used for system-level programming, game development, and resource-intensive applications. It is an extension of the C programming language with added features like object-oriented programming. C++ is known for its high performance and efficiency, making it ideal for applications that require low-level control over hardware resources.
5. Ruby
Ruby is a dynamic and elegant programming language that is often associated with web development. It has a clean syntax and a strong focus on simplicity and productivity. Ruby is widely used for building web applications and is the language behind popular web frameworks like Ruby on Rails. It is also known for its vibrant and supportive community.
These are just a few of the top coding languages to consider learning. Each language has its own strengths and weaknesses, so it’s important to choose the one that aligns with your goals and interests. Remember, learning a programming language is just the first step – continuous practice and hands-on experience are key to becoming a proficient programmer.

Useful resources for learning coding
When it comes to learning coding, there are plenty of resources available that can help beginners and experienced programmers alike. Whether you prefer interactive online courses, video tutorials, or books, there is something out there for everyone. Here are some useful resources that can help you on your coding journey:
- Codecademy: Codecademy is an interactive online platform that offers coding courses in various programming languages. It provides hands-on exercises and quizzes to help you learn and practice coding skills in a structured way.
- FreeCodeCamp: FreeCodeCamp is a non-profit organization that offers a wide range of coding challenges and projects. It also has a supportive community where you can ask questions and get help from fellow learners.
- Stack Overflow: Stack Overflow is a popular question and answer site for programmers. It’s a great resource for finding solutions to coding problems and learning from experienced developers.
- Programming books: There are numerous books available on coding that cover various programming languages and concepts. Some popular ones include “The Pragmatic Programmer” by Andrew Hunt and David Thomas, “Clean Code” by Robert C. Martin, and “Eloquent JavaScript” by Marijn Haverbeke.
- Online coding communities: Joining online coding communities, such as GitHub and Reddit, can provide you with valuable insights, tips, and feedback from other programmers. It’s a great way to connect with like-minded individuals and learn from their experiences.

Common challenges faced by beginner coders
Learning to code can be an exciting and challenging journey, especially for beginners. It involves mastering new concepts, problem-solving, and navigating through a vast amount of information. Here are some common challenges faced by beginner coders:
- Understanding syntax: One of the initial challenges faced by beginner coders is understanding the syntax of the programming language they are learning. Syntax refers to the rules and structure of the language, and it can take some time to get used to the specific syntax of a programming language. Beginners may struggle to remember the correct syntax for various statements, functions, and variables.
- Debugging and troubleshooting: Another common challenge is debugging and troubleshooting code. As a beginner, it can be frustrating to encounter errors and spend a significant amount of time trying to identify and fix them. Debugging involves finding and correcting errors in the code, and it requires a systematic approach and attention to detail.
- Understanding concepts: Beginner coders often face the challenge of grasping fundamental programming concepts. These concepts include data types, loops, conditionals, and functions. Understanding how these concepts work and how to apply them correctly can be overwhelming at first. It requires practice and experimentation to build a solid understanding of these concepts.
- Managing complexity and scale: As beginners progress and start working on more complex projects, managing the complexity and scale of the code becomes a challenge. It involves designing and organizing code in a way that is maintainable, scalable, and efficient. Beginners may struggle with structuring their code and managing dependencies between different components.
- Staying motivated: Learning to code can be a long and sometimes frustrating process. Beginner coders may face challenges in staying motivated, especially when they encounter difficulties or feel overwhelmed. It is important to find ways to stay motivated, such as setting goals, celebrating small victories, and seeking support from the coding community.
